Heritage listing
Details This list entry was subject to a Minor Amendment on 03/10/018 TQ 63 SE 5/231 LAMBERHURST SCOTNEY Bridge over the River Bewl at TQ 6872 3495 (Formerly listed as Bridge over the River Teise at TQ 6872 3495) GV II Bridge. Circa 1840. Sandstone and red brick. Single brick arch over stream with stone embankment walls. Dressed stone parapet walls, splayed on plan and with coping stones. Part of Edward Hussey's improvements to Scotney Castle park. Listing NGR: TQ6875334965 Legacy The contents of this record have been generated from a legacy data system.
